NBA Honors Veterans with Patriotic Socks
As part of the NBA’s “Hoops for Troops” week, which started yesterday and goes through Veterans Day next week, players will be wearing shirt, headbands, wristbands, and most importantly, socks, with a patriotic American flag motif. Raptors 905 Unveils New Uniforms
The Toronto Raptors farm club, known as “Raptors 905” (see their logo set here), unveiled their inaugural team uniforms at a media event in Mississauga, Ontario this afternoon.
